摘要
SCR脱硝吸收剂制备工艺可分为纯氨法、氨水法和尿素法。为了适应不同的电厂实际情况,笔者对三种工艺从技术、经济方面进行比较,得出下列结论:尿素法最安全,但投资、运行总费用最高;纯氨法运行、投资费用最低,但安全性要求高;氨水法初投资及运行费用都较高,运行业绩较少。
Absorbent adopted in DeNOx system having selective catalytic reduction (SCR) technology can be made by three methods, i.e. pure ammonia, ammonia-water and urea. By comparing those methods in technology and economy, this paper aims to find out a favorable option based on various requirements for the power plant. It comes to a conclusion that urea is the safest way but requires the highest cost both in construction and operation; pure ammonia spends the least cost but requires the highest safety factor; while ammonia-water requires higher cost in both construction and operation, and its running performance is not so much right now.
